A multichannel non-stationary queuing system model of stadium checkpoint system studied. Input flow of model is based on statistical information of visitors flows from football matches in the Russian Federation. An algorithm choosing the shortest queue for implementing a policy of choosing a non-random queue presented. Result of comparing different policies described for input rate like real ones. The result is substantiated by comparing the functioning of the stationary QS with different queue selection policies in 3 modes: underload, load, overload.
